Description | Isovanillin is an aldehyde oxidase inhibitor[1]. Antispasmodic activities[2]. Antidiarrheal activities[3]. |
Target | Aldehyde oxidase[1] |
In Vitro | Isovanillin is not a substrate for aldehyde oxidase and therefore it is metabolized to isovanillic acid predominantly by aldehyde dehydrogenase[1]. Isovanillin is relaxant of ileum contractions induced by 5-HT (IC50=356±50μM) [2]. |
In Vivo | Isovanillin (2 mg/kg & 5 mg/kg) and iso-acetovanillon (2 mg/kg & 5 mg/kg) both have antidiarrheal and anti-motility effect on gastrointestinal tract[3]. |
